To convert time from 220 yards to 200 meters, you need to consider the difference in distance and the conversion factor between yards and meters. Since 220 yards is equivalent to 201.168 meters, you can use the ratio of 220 yards to 201.168 meters to convert the time. For example, if you ran 220 yards in 30 seconds, you would calculate the equivalent time for 200 meters by multiplying 30 seconds by the ratio of 200 meters to 201.168 meters.
